Evo is a Newcastle-based design and manufacturing house that started at the grassroots level, with our directors envisioning and developing library automation solutions while completing their engineering degrees at the University of Newcastle. 
Having founded Evo (then trading as Tecevo) in 2005, we turned this innovative business into a reality and continued to refine concepts to meet client’s requirements.
Evo Technology has continued to expand out into various other industries partnering with technology-minded customers.
Two men in black T-shirts with orange text working on plans at a workshop table, illuminated by sunlight through a window.
We are very proud of our library sorting solutions, currently present in 27 library branches in Singapore and across Australia and New Zealand.

 From initial concept through to overseeing production, and every stage in between, Evo offers complete product design and engineering service, with comprehensive in-house manufacturing capability to create commercially successful products.
With a global footprint, we offer 15-years’ experience in:
  • Special builds
  • Library automation market
  • Out-of-home advertising market
  • Interactive and physical advertising displays
  • Sculptures
  • Vending machines
